You did not give out the diameter? But let's do it step by step anyway.
*Let's just say your diameter was 63*
Formula to find circumference(C): C=pi d
3.14 times diameter so, 3.14 x 63
3.14 x 63=197.82
Then multiply your answer above to how many revolution the ferris wheel made:
197.82 x 12= 2373.84 ft is your answer. (Round to nearest hundredth foot if needed)
